Summary

The biofabrication market is transitioning from experimental deployments to early industrial scale, driven by regenerative medicine, advanced biomaterials, and automated 3D bioprinting workflows. Leading Biofabrication market companies are consolidating share through IP depth, pharma partnerships, and GMP capabilities. From US$ 2.05 Billion in 2025, the market is projected to reach US$ 6.16 Billion by 2032, reflecting a 20.30% CAGR.

Ranking Methodology

Company rankings are derived from a multi-factor scoring model built specifically for biofabrication. Core inputs include 2025 biofabrication-specific revenue, five-year revenue trajectory, and disclosed order backlog or project wins with pharmaceutical, biotech, and academic customers. We weight technology differentiation heavily, assessing IP strength, bioprinting resolution, multi-material capabilities, automation maturity, and regulatory-grade quality systems. Portfolio breadth, including printers, bioinks, software, and contract biofabrication services, is evaluated alongside geographic footprint and installed base. Service coverage considers application support, validation services, and ability to execute long-term GMP manufacturing or maintenance contracts. Each Biofabrication market company receives a composite score, normalised across financial, technological, and commercial pillars to avoid size bias. Qualitative inputs from partnerships, M&A, and pipeline disclosures are used to fine-tune close rankings, ensuring that innovation-led challengers are visible even when absolute revenue is lower.

Detailed Company Profiles

1

CELLINK (BICO Group)

CELLINK, part of BICO Group, is a leading end-to-end provider of bioprinters, bioinks, and biofabrication services for research and industry.

Key Financials: 2025 Biofabrication revenue US$ 260.00 Million; estimated segment CAGR 19.50%.
Flagship Products: BIO X6, LUMEN X, HXP bioprinting suite
2025-2026 Actions: Scaled GMP-ready facilities, launched high-throughput platforms, and deepened strategic alliances with top-ten pharma companies.
Three-line SWOT: Industry-leading installed base and broad portfolio; Integration complexity across acquired brands; Opportunity—expansion of GMP biofabrication services for cell and gene therapies.
Notable Customers: Top 10 global pharma (undisclosed), leading universities, major regenerative medicine startups
2

Organovo Holdings Inc.

Organovo develops bioprinted human tissues for drug discovery, disease modeling, and early-stage regenerative medicine indications with strong clinical focus.

Key Financials: 2025 Biofabrication revenue US$ 190.00 Million; R&D spend 32.00% of revenue.
Flagship Products: NovoGen MMX platform, bioprinted liver tissues, kidney disease models
2025-2026 Actions: Refocused portfolio on high-value liver and kidney applications, strengthened pharma co-development pipelines, and streamlined operations.
Three-line SWOT: Deep know-how in functional tissues; Narrow platform commercialization beyond therapeutics; Opportunity—growing demand for predictive, human-relevant preclinical models.
Notable Customers: Global pharmaceutical companies, mid-size biotechs, academic medical centers
3

3D Systems (Regenerative Medicine & Bioprinting)

3D Systems leverages its established 3D printing leadership to deliver advanced bioprinting platforms and regenerative medicine solutions via strategic partnerships.

Key Financials: 2025 Biofabrication revenue US$ 180.00 Million; operating margin 15.20%.
Flagship Products: Figure 4 MED systems, bioprinting platforms, collagen-based biofabrication solutions
2025-2026 Actions: Integrated biofabrication into broader healthcare portfolio, scaled joint ventures in regenerative medicine, and invested in regulatory-grade manufacturing.
Three-line SWOT: Strong hardware engineering and global reach; Biofabrication still a small part of total business; Opportunity—cross-selling into installed medical customer base.
Notable Customers: Medical device OEMs, hospital systems, regenerative medicine partners
4

Aspect Biosystems

Aspect Biosystems focuses on therapeutic biofabrication using microfluidic bioprinting to develop cell-based therapies with pharma collaborators.

Key Financials: 2025 Biofabrication revenue US$ 140.00 Million; strategic partnership funding US$ 300.00 Million committed.
Flagship Products: RX1 microfluidic bioprinter, therapeutic tissue programs, bespoke cell therapy constructs
2025-2026 Actions: Expanded cell therapy manufacturing capabilities, strengthened big-pharma partnerships, and advanced preclinical pipeline.
Three-line SWOT: Highly differentiated microfluidic platform; Concentrated exposure to a small number of partners; Opportunity—first-in-class bioprinted therapeutic approvals.
Notable Customers: Top-tier pharmaceutical partners, advanced cell therapy developers
5

REGEMAT 3D

REGEMAT 3D supplies modular bioprinting systems and biomaterials tailored for orthopedic, cartilage, and dental research and early clinical projects.

Key Financials: 2025 Biofabrication revenue US$ 110.00 Million; export share 78.00%.
Flagship Products: REG4Life bioprinter, R-GEN biomaterials, custom scaffold platforms
2025-2026 Actions: Launched modular platforms, expanded distribution in Latin America and Middle East, and emphasized application-specific packages.
Three-line SWOT: Flexible, customizable systems; Lower brand awareness in North America; Opportunity—orthopedic and dental regeneration growth in emerging markets.
Notable Customers: Orthopedic research labs, dental schools, hospital-based research centers
6

Poietis

Poietis specializes in high-resolution laser-assisted bioprinting, particularly for skin tissue engineering and cosmetic testing applications.

Key Financials: 2025 Biofabrication revenue US$ 100.00 Million; recurring services and contracts 46.00% of revenue.
Flagship Products: Next-Generation BioPrinter (NGB), BioMation platform, clinical-grade skin constructs
2025-2026 Actions: Expanded GMP skin biofabrication suites, deepened cosmetic partnerships, and advanced regulatory pathways for therapeutic skin.
Three-line SWOT: Unique laser bioprinting resolution; Focused primarily on skin applications; Opportunity—regulatory acceptance of biofabricated skin for burns and chronic wounds.
Notable Customers: Global cosmetics majors, European hospitals, dermatology research institutes
7

CollPlant Biotechnologies

CollPlant develops plant-derived recombinant human collagen biomaterials and bioinks that underpin multiple biofabrication and tissue engineering applications.

Key Financials: 2025 Biofabrication revenue US$ 90.00 Million; licensing and royalties 40.00% of segment revenue.
Flagship Products: rhCollagen bioinks, tissue scaffold materials, breast reconstruction matrices
2025-2026 Actions: Broadened licensing deals, ramped biomaterial manufacturing, and targeted high-margin reconstructive and orthopedic markets.
Three-line SWOT: Differentiated collagen source and strong IP; Limited in-house hardware offerings; Opportunity—material standardization for large-scale biofabrication workflows.
Notable Customers: Biofabrication platform vendors, medical device OEMs, regenerative medicine startups
8

Allevi by 3D Systems

Allevi by 3D Systems offers accessible, benchtop bioprinters and open-material platforms targeting academic labs and early-stage biofabrication users.

Key Financials: 2025 Biofabrication revenue US$ 80.00 Million; installed base growth 18.70% year-on-year.
Flagship Products: Allevi 3 bioprinter, Allevi 6 bioprinter, Allevi Cloud software
2025-2026 Actions: Released education-focused bundles, broadened materials ecosystem, and integrated with 3D Systems’ healthcare solutions.
Three-line SWOT: Strong brand in academia and entry-level systems; Lower penetration in GMP industrial settings; Opportunity—upgrade path as research users scale to clinical manufacturing.
Notable Customers: Universities, teaching hospitals, early-stage biotech startups
9

ROKIT Healthcare

ROKIT Healthcare develops clinical-grade bioprinters and workflows for hospital-based, patient-specific tissue engineering at the point of care.

Key Financials: 2025 Biofabrication revenue US$ 70.00 Million; Asia-Pacific revenue share 62.00%.
Flagship Products: Dr. INVIVO 4D series, skin and cartilage bioprinting kits, hospital-focused solutions
2025-2026 Actions: Expanded regulatory approvals, piloted point-of-care programs, and targeted government-backed regenerative medicine hubs.
Three-line SWOT: Strong foothold in point-of-care clinical settings; Heavy regulatory complexity across markets; Opportunity—government-funded regenerative medicine initiatives in Asia and Middle East.
Notable Customers: Tertiary care hospitals, national research institutes, plastic surgery centers
10

UpNano GmbH

UpNano delivers two-photon microfabrication systems that enable nano- and micro-scale biofabricated scaffolds for advanced cell culture and tissue models.

Key Financials: 2025 Biofabrication revenue US$ 60.00 Million; R&D intensity 29.50% of revenue.
Flagship Products: NanoOne Bio system, biocompatible resins, nano-structured scaffold solutions
2025-2026 Actions: Expanded into biocompatible materials, opened new demo centers, and targeted high-end cell therapy labs.
Three-line SWOT: Unmatched micro-scale resolution; Niche, high-price positioning limits volume; Opportunity—increasing demand for precise microenvironments in cell therapy and organoid research.
Notable Customers: Advanced research institutes, cell therapy laboratories, high-end biotech companies

Biofabrication Market Regional Competitive Landscape

North America remains the largest and most mature regional market, underpinned by strong NIH funding, a dense biotech ecosystem, and early adoption of GMP biofabrication. CELLINK (BICO Group), Organovo, and 3D Systems lead, supported by numerous academic centers using Allevi and other platforms for preclinical research and translational projects.

Europe shows balanced growth, combining stringent regulatory oversight with large academic consortia and Horizon Europe funding. REGEMAT 3D, Poietis, CollPlant, and UpNano play prominent roles, while CELLINK and 3D Systems deepen footprints via local distributors and collaborations focused on skin, cartilage, and orthopedic applications.

Asia-Pacific is shifting from hardware import dependence to indigenous innovation, driven by government-backed regenerative medicine initiatives. ROKIT Healthcare anchors hospital-based deployments in South Korea, while Chinese and Japanese Biofabrication market companies expand capabilities. Global leaders like CELLINK and 3D Systems localize support to capture fast-growing demand.

Latin America is an emerging but strategic market, with Brazil and Mexico investing in regenerative medicine and biomaterials research. REGEMAT 3D leverages Spanish-language support and cost-effective platforms, while North American vendors engage via reference labs and distributor networks, focusing on education and preclinical adoption before full clinical scale-up.

The Middle East and Africa are at a nascent stage but benefit from flagship national healthcare and innovation programs, particularly in Gulf Cooperation Council countries. ROKIT Healthcare and REGEMAT 3D participate in pilot hospital projects, while CELLINK and Poietis supply reference centers involved in advanced wound care and burn treatment research.
